Hey folks — handing off LiftPath release duties to Mara while I'm out. The elevator-dispatch simulator ships Thursdays; build 4.2 is staged and the scenario packs are frozen. Only gotcha: the dispatch-core artifact won't promote unless it's signed before the smoke suite kicks off, so do that first, not after. Everything else is in the runbook on the Ostermill wiki. Mara, you'll need the deploy key to push to the release channel, so pasting it here for the sync notes.

deploy key for tawip-bawig: bky13_1zSxDtVxnNkjh

Ticket: Tide-table widget showing stale data

The Shorewind tide-table widget has been frozen since Tuesday — turns out the credential it uses to pull from the internal Moonpull forecast service expired and nobody got paged. Low urgency but it looks bad on the coastal dashboard. A fresh key has been issued; please roll it into the next release. The replacement key is below.

service key, fawip-bajef: kto11_Qt5wZK9vdNC

Cleaning-crew access: the evening crew from Pellerin Services arrives weekdays after 19:00 and works floor by floor, starting in the Warrick Wing. Team assistants should ensure meeting rooms are unlocked and confidential papers are cleared before then. The crew enters via the service corridor door, which requires the shared access code listed below.

staff pass of kawip-hawef = bdg-QLP-2

Minutes — Management Meeting

Prepared for the incoming director. Topic: possible acquisition of Greyfen Analytics. Due diligence 70% complete. Valuation gap remains; Greyfen seeks a premium. Integration risks flagged by Ops. Decision deferred to next month. Talla Nyberg leads negotiations. Our walk-away position is stated below.

board note of fawig-kagup: Only 48 of the 435 pilot accounts renewed Rusion, so a churn review is set for September 12. Fenwynox Logistics is in early talks to buy Sorielek Systems for about $117.8 million.